Output 83d6bb101a3b6762a2a0f61624879b5dde663328816f924162b5e848ff05e9cb:3

value
377113180
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f16d40508488a8a71400e792f4bf6049c4f28f3 OP_EQUAL
address
34XQDd1sEMvw1QwqHDJ4q6cv5hduq377xj
transaction
83d6bb101a3b6762a2a0f61624879b5dde663328816f924162b5e848ff05e9cb
spent
true